You can open a bug report in the groff bug tracker
(https://savannah.gnu.org/bugs/?group=groff&func=additem), describing
the problem and attaching a patch.  You don't need to create an
account to submit a bug, but creating one lets the system email you
with updates or questions.

Alternately, you can post a patch to this email list.  But the bug
tracker is generally the better option, in case no developer has the
bandwidth to handle it right away: a mailing list post might get
forgotten, while a bug report will remain open until resolved in some
way.
